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brown Mastiff Bat | Puna Ibis |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Pelecaniformes (Pelecaniformes) |
| Family | Molossidae | Threskiornithidae |
| Genus | Promops | Plegadis |
| Species | Promops nasutus | Plegadis ridgwayi |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brown Mastiff Bat and Puna Ibis share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
